Delores Jewel Roubieu

Delores Jewel Roubieu, a cherished soul and beloved matriarch, was born on May 20, 1935, in Saratoga, Texas. She graced this world with her presence until August 27, 2024, when she peacefully departed at Harbor Hospice, surrounded by love and memories that would linger in the hearts of all who knew her.

Delores was a pioneering spirit, having dedicated her career to social work at the local hospital, where her compassion and unwavering dedication left a lasting impact on the community. She had a remarkable ability to connect with people, ensuring that they felt heard and valued. Her words resonated deeply; when she spoke, it was not just the content of her voice but the strength of her character that commanded attention. Delores was known to stand her ground, and those affirmations were a testament to her resilience and the love she had for her family.

More than just a professional, Delores relished the roles she played in her family life. She earned the affectionate title of "Queen," enjoying moments in the spotlight, be it through family celebrations or while offering her culinary critiques that became a hallmark of family gatherings. She delighted in cooking, passing down her skills and love for the kitchen to her children, ensuring that her legacy would be tasted from generation to generation.

Delores thrived during family cookouts, where laughter and the aroma of delicious food filled the air. She was especially fond of Mexican food, fried shrimp, and her passion for birthdays, crawfish boils, and card games created countless cherished memories with her loved ones. A true sports mom, she fervently supported her favorite team, the Houston Texans, embodying the spirit of love and loyalty to both her family and her chosen teams.

The joys of nature brought Delores happiness, especially her fondness for birds and her beloved dog, Fluff, who brought a sparkle to her days. She loved to fish—an activity that matched her love for both peace and excitement, indulging in the simple pleasures that life offered.

Delores is survived by her loving boyfriend, Melvin Sexton Jr.; her devoted sons, Curtis Paul Roubieu III and wife Lorna, and Otis Eugene Roubieu and Becky Roubieu; her daughter, Vicki Roubieu-Martino; and her sister-in-law, LaJuan Martin. She leaves behind an expansive lineage of love, including 11 grandchildren, 29 great-grandchildren, and 14 great-great-grandchildren, alongside numerous nieces, nephews, and a multitude of friends who were blessed to share in her life.

Though Delores has left this earthly realm, the light she shared remains forever etched in the hearts of her family and friends. She joins her beloved father, Otis William Martin; mother, Gloria Stevens Martin; and her brothers, Kenneth Martin, Val Martin, and Eugene Martin, in eternal peace. Delores Jewel Roubieu will be profoundly missed but fondly remembered, cherished for her indomitable spirit and the unconditional love she spread throughout her lifetime.

Honoring Delores as pallbearers are Matthew Roubieu, Curtis Snow, Michael Bourque, Gage Jeffcoat, Josh Roubieu, David Bindert and Jake Lindsey.

Visitation and funeral services will be held on September 6, 2024, at Faith & Family Funeral Services in Batson, TX. The visitation will begin at 10:00 AM, followed by the funeral service at 11:00 AM, allowing family and friends to come together in remembrance of a truly remarkable woman.
